Precise Orbit Determination for BeiDou Satellites during Eclipse Seasons

During the eclipse seasons,BeiDou IGSO/MEO satellites perform attitude maneuvers from yaw‐steering to yaw‐fixed,while the nominal yaw‐angle is fixed to zero.Unfortunately,different levels of the orbit accuracy degradationsin the Precise Orbit Determination (POD) processoccur in this period.In this paper,a reduce‐dynamic orbital model with additionalpseudo‐stochastic parameters is introduced to improve the orbit quality.The geometrical corrections in observations and the force variations related to attitude are modeled and investigated.The pseudo‐stochastic orbit modeling techniques are applied for absorbing effectsof the mis‐modeled part of the attitudemaneuvers.The POD resultsindicate a significantly improved performance of orbit with appropriate pseudo‐stochastic parameters for BeiDou satellites during eclipse seasons.
